产品信息
什么是 Aws lambda?
AWS Lambda 是一项计算服务,它运行您的代码以响应事件并自动为您管理底层计算资源。您可以使用AWS Lambda 通过自定义逻辑扩展其他 AWS 服务,或创建您自己的以 AWS 规模、性能和安全性运行的后端服务。AWS Lambda 可以自动运行代码,以响应对 Amazon S3 存储桶中的对象的修改、从 Amazon SNS 发送的通知、到达 Amazon Kinesis 流的消息或 Amazon DynamoDB 中的表更新。
Lambda 在高可用性计算基础设施上运行您的代码,并执行计算资源的所有管理,包括服务器和操作系统维护、容量配置和自动扩展、代码和安全补丁部署以及代码监控和日志记录。您所需要做的就是提供代码。
介绍AWS Lambda 函数
您在AWS Lambda 上运行的代码称为“Lambda 函数”。创建 Lambda 函数后,它随时可以在触发后立即运行,类似于电子表格中的公式。每个函数都包含您的代码以及一些相关的配置信息,包括函数名称和资源要求。 Lambda 函数是“无状态”的,与底层基础设施没有关联,因此 Lambda 可以根据需要快速启动任意数量的函数副本,以适应传入事件的速率。
将代码上传到AWS Lambda 后,您可以将您的函数与特定 AWS 资源(例如特定 Amazon S3 存储桶、Amazon DynamoDB 表、Amazon Kinesis 流或 Amazon SNS 通知)关联。然后,当资源发生变化时,Lambda 将执行您的函数并根据需要管理计算资源,以便跟上传入的请求。
如何使用 Aws lambda?
AWS Lambda 是一种计算服务,它根据事件运行用户代码,并自动管理底层计算资源。它使用户能够通过自定义逻辑扩展其他 AWS 服务,或构建具备 AWS 规模、性能和安全性的后端服务。
Aws lambda 的核心功能
云托管
多语言
VPS
通知
短信
Aws lambda 的使用场景
- 响应 Amazon S3 存储桶中对象的修改来自动运行代码。
- 处理来自 Amazon SNS 的通知。
- 处理到达 Amazon Kinesis 流的消息。
- 响应 Amazon DynamoDB 中的表更新。
- 通过自定义逻辑扩展其他 AWS 服务。
- 创建具备 AWS 规模、性能和安全性的后端服务。
Aws lambda 的常见问题
AWS Lambda做什么的?
我如何使用AWS Lambda?
AWS Lambda有哪些核心功能?
AWS Lambda有哪些应用场景?





















